Abstract

In previous calculations of the reflecting properties of the ionosphere use has often been made of a 2 × 2 reflection coefficient matrix. This is a true reflection coefficient only in the free space below the ionosphere, but not within the ionospheric plasma. Here a new 2 × 2 matrix is defined which is a true reflection coefficient at all levels both within and outside the ionosphere. It is useful for a detailed study of the processes of reflection, absorption and coupling within the ionosphere.
